给hexo添加网页图标
- hexo + yilia 主题设置图标方法
- hexo 其他设置图标方法
hexo + yilia 主题设置图标方法
1. 制作ico小图标
推荐一个ico制作网站:https://www.bitbug.net/
选择一张图片上传,生成.ico文件,这里建议32*32大小,保存名为favicon.ico文件,这里建议32*32大小,保存名为favicon
2. 放置图标
将 favicon.ico 图标文件放到 themes/yilia/source/img 文件夹下,
找到 hexo\themes\yilia\layout_partial\head.ejs,修改下面一段代码为:
<% if (theme.favicon){ %>
<link rel=”icon” href=”/img/favicon.ico”>
<% } %>
3. 部署
hexo g
hexo s
hexo d
hexo 其他设置图标方法
Hexo next主题默认的网页图标长这个样子:
1. 下载或制作ico小图标
如上一种方法。
2. 放置图标
下载的图标重命名为favicon.ico,位置放在/themes/xxx/source/images中。
3. 放置图标
修改主题配置文件,在/themes/xxx/_config.yml中修改成自己的图标。
favicon:
small: /images/favicon.ico
#medium: /images/favicon-32x32-next.png
medium: /images/favicon.ico
apple_touch_icon: /images/apple-touch-icon-next.png
safari_pinned_tab: /images/logo.svg
#android_manifest: /manifest.json